What Are V-Port Ball Valves?
At their core, V-Port Ball Valves are a type of quarter-turn valve that combines the simplicity of ball valves with enhanced flow control capabilities. Unlike traditional ball valves featuring a smooth, round ball, V-Port versions incorporate a V-shaped notch or segment on the ball or the seat. This design innovation enables fine-tuned modulation of fluid flow, allowing operators to adjust flow rates precisely rather than simply turning the valve fully open or closed.
Because of this capability, many operators consider V-Port Ball Valves the ideal choice when applications require more than just on/off functionality but less complexity than multi-turn globe or needle valves.
The Design Behind Precise and Effortless Flow Control
To appreciate V-Port Ball Valves’ benefits, it’s essential to grasp how their design influences functionality:
V-Shaped Notch for Accurate Flow Modulation
The defining feature of these valves is the V-shaped notch cut into the valve ball or seat. As the valve rotates from closed to open, the V-notch progressively exposes a larger flow path, creating a more predictable and linear flow characteristic. This is markedly different from standard ball valves, which exhibit rapid flow increase near full open positions, often resulting in less precise control.
Quarter-Turn Operation for Ease and Speed
V-Port Ball Valves retain the quarter-turn operation of conventional ball valves, meaning a 90-degree turn fully opens or closes the valve. This quick operation is not only efficient for process adjustments but also minimizes operator fatigue in manual control applications.
Durable Seals and Construction for Long-Term Service
Typically constructed from robust metals such as stainless steel, carbon steel, or alloy steels, V-Port Ball Valves are built to withstand harsh industrial environments, pressure fluctuations, and varying temperatures. The seals are engineered to ensure tight shutoff while accommodating the V-notch’s unique geometry.
Advantages of V-Port Ball Valves in Industrial Applications
The combination of design elements translates into tangible benefits across various sectors:
1. Enhanced Flow Control Accuracy
The V-shaped notch provides superior throttling ability compared to conventional ball valves. This means processes requiring finely tuned flow rates—such as chemical dosing, steam flow regulation, or mixing operations—can rely on these valves to maintain precise control.
2. Reduced Cavitation and Noise
By controlling the velocity and turbulence of the fluid passing through the valve, V-Port Ball Valves help minimize cavitation—a common issue in throttling services that can damage valve components and pipelines. Additionally, their design helps reduce flow noise, important for maintaining safe and comfortable working conditions.
3. Easy Operation and Maintenance
The quarter-turn operation simplifies valve manipulation, reducing manual labor and speeding up process adjustments. Moreover, the modular design often permits easy disassembly and maintenance, lowering downtime and associated costs.
4. Versatility Across Media Types
V-Port Ball Valves cater to a wide range of fluids—including liquids, gases, slurries, and corrosive chemicals—thanks to the availability of various body materials and sealing options. This flexibility extends their use across industries like oil and gas, chemical processing, water treatment, and power generation.
Common Industries Leveraging V-Port Ball Valves
Due to their versatility and precision, these valves have found extensive adoption in numerous sectors requiring dependable flow control.
Chemical and Petrochemical Processing
In these sophisticated environments, maintaining accurate chemical feed rates and reaction conditions is critical. The ability of V-Port Ball Valves to control flow rates with precision contributes to process efficiency, product quality, and safety.
Power Generation Plants
Steam and cooling water flows require vigilant management to optimize system performance and protect equipment. V-Port Ball Valves allow plant operators to modulate flow smoothly while guarding against cavitation and thermal shocks.
Water and Wastewater Treatment
Precise flow control is essential in dosing treatment chemicals or regulating water pressure. The robustness and adaptability of V-Port Ball Valves make them well-suited for these utilities.
Food and Beverage Industry
Hygienic standards and exact flow rates are necessary in processing lines for flavoring agents, additives, or steam sterilization. V-Port Ball Valves, available in sanitary designs, help meet these industry requirements.
Installation and Maintenance Best Practices for Optimal Performance
To maximize the benefits of V-Port Ball Valves, following best practices in installation and upkeep is crucial.
Proper Sizing and Selection
Specifying the correct plug type, size, and material compatible with process conditions ensures longevity and functional accuracy. Consulting manufacturers’ guidelines and process engineers enables suitable valve choices.
Correct Installation Orientation
Installing valves according to flow direction indications and ensuring proper alignment reduces wear and flow disturbances, which can degrade performance over time.
Routine Inspection and Cleaning
Regular inspections help identify seal wear, erosion, or buildup that might hinder valve operation. Scheduled cleaning preserves the V-notch geometry and prevents flow restriction.
Lubrication and Seal Replacement
Appropriate lubrication of moving parts and prompt seal replacement avoid operational problems and extend service life.
